The NutriBullet by the makers of Magic Bullet is a personal blender that is self-contained and simple to use. It includes an electric blender base with a number of attachments for the user and offers a healthy alternative to blending food by breaking down ingredients in their most nutritious states.

Why aren't the top and bottom wheels locking together?

Both top and bottom male/female wheels supposedly to lock for spinning, aren’t actually locking correctly hence smoke is produced, I would assume due to the friction of an imperfect lock. How to resolve? I’ve tried disassembling from the base but it just seems a hassle of a job considering that I’m not even sure I can find replacement wheels. It seems one of the wheels was consumed by the friction initiated with power on. Help!
